Learn to create a positive work environment by accentuating the positive and illuminating the negative
Illuminate argues that we can't create positive work environments without accepting the existence of the negative. Though "positive thinking" has its place in the work world, we can't ignore the negative, whether it be in the form of challenges, problems, limitations, or other negative business realities. In order to foster healthy, functional business, we have to create a culture that allows for open expression and the sharing of ideas-especially when those ideas are negative in nature.
The key is that negative situations and conditions should be introduced and dealt with in a strictly positive light. The result is an organization able to look at itself honestly and stay alert to possible threats. A unique kind of business book, Illuminate is written in the style of an allegorical fable that teaches you a three-step process for confronting, examining, and fixing any problem in the office.
- Offers practical ways for dealing with negative situations to achieve positive outcomes
- Serious wisdom wrapped in a fictional format
- Author David Corbin operates a successful consultancy that helps industry and government maximize productivity and, therefore, profitability
- Corbin is also the star and co-director of the hit 2007 self-help film Pass It On; he is featured in the 2009 Napoleon Hill Foundation Film, Three Feet From Gold
If your corporate culture can't deal with the negative without creating more negativity, this is the perfect guide for creating and sustaining a culture of positive change.

About the Author
David M. Corbin has spent more than thirty years as a successful businessman, entrepreneur, consultant, and award-winning inventor. He has consulted with CEOs, politicians, and bestselling authors, providing keynotes and training programs for enhanced productivity and profitability. He is also the Executive Producer, Co-director, and star of the 2007 film Pass It On and is featured in the 2009 film Think and Grow Rich: Three Feet from Gold.
